1. What Are Affiliate Links?
An affiliate link is a special URL that contains a tracking code. When you click an affiliate link on IdentityBastion.com and complete a purchase or sign up for a service the company pays us a small referral commission.
Here is a simple example of how it works:
- You visit IdentityBastion.com and read our NordVPN review
- You click our NordVPN link (which contains our tracking code)
- You purchase a NordVPN subscription on NordVPN’s website
- NordVPN pays us a commission for referring you
- You pay exactly the same price you would have paid without clicking our link
The commission comes from the company’s marketing budget — not from your pocket. You never pay more because of our affiliate relationship.

4. FTC Compliance
In accordance with the United States Federal Trade Commission (FTC) guidelines on endorsements and testimonials (16 CFR Part 255) we disclose our affiliate relationships clearly and prominently.
The FTC requires that material connections between endorsers and advertisers be disclosed. An affiliate commission constitutes a material connection and we take this requirement seriously.
